Industrial Hemp Market Outlook (2023 to 2033)

Industrial hemp is made from cannabis sativa and is used across the world to manufacture various commercial goods. It is a rich source of fiber and oilseed. These plants are grown in more than 30 countries across the globe. There is a lot of confusion between hemp and marijuana as there is a wide range of similarities between the two plants.

What are the factors that favor growth in the market?

A plant with eastern Asian origins, whose cultivation was long outlawed in many nations due to tetrahydrocannabinol (THC), a hallucinogenic secondary metabolite found in many plant sections.

Recently, the European Union reinstated the production of fiber, seeds, and flowers from select genotypes of Cannabis sativa L., generally known as industrial hemp, with a THC level of less than 0.2% w/w. Following the European regulation, the Italian government enacted a new law governing the cultivation, sale, and use of industrial hemp.

Because of the favorable legal environment and the novel products that may be made from this crop, it is therefore anticipated that its farming will rise over the coming years. These plants used for industrial purposes typically have a spindly main stalk covered in leaves. Hemp plants typically grow to a height of 6 to 15 feet and are regarded as a low-maintenance crop. The time between planting and harvesting might be anything between 70 and 140 days, depending on the crop, the purpose, and the weather.

How are Nations regulating this market?

It’s often confused with marijuana due to visual similarities however there are certain differentiators in these varieties of hemp. The THC content of industrial hemp is carefully regulated in Canada and the European Union, where it must be less than 0.3 percent, as opposed to marijuana, which has a THC content ranging from 3 to 30 percent.

The majority of pro-hemp initiatives in the US these days concentrate on defining and separating such hemp from marijuana. Some pro-hemp advocates want the USDA to take over control of domestic hemp production from the DEA.
